Output ee5ccf309f6d2212d035890cc76e3564905fe22cbabfd5fe559dc39bb8e80806:2

value
1366641
script pubkey
OP_0 OP_PUSHBYTES_20 3d7dd0f0a9b742a23a3c7efd9306bd314ea2dfec
address
bc1q847apu9fkap2yw3u0m7exp4ax9829hlv65ygxp
transaction
ee5ccf309f6d2212d035890cc76e3564905fe22cbabfd5fe559dc39bb8e80806
confirmations
107531
spent
true